Medical Incineration Process:

Medical incineration involves burning medical waste, such as infectious and sharp objects, at high temperatures. The process converts potentially harmful materials into harmless gas and ash. Modern incineration plants are equipped with sophisticated air pollution control technology to minimize emissions and protect public health.

FAQs:

1. Is medical incineration safe for the environment?
Modern incineration plants feature advanced air pollution control mechanisms to minimize emissions. Nonetheless, environmental regulations and expert guidance must be followed rigorously.

2. What are the costs associated with medical incineration?
The overall costs depend on factors like plant size, technology selected and operating expenses. Potential cost savings can be achieved through energy generation and materials recovery.

3. What materials can be incinerated?
Medical waste such as soiled disposable medical devices, animal carcasses and sharps can be incinerated. Plastic packaging materials should be minimized before incineration.
